Jerome Bixby

Drexel Jerome Lewis Bibxy (January 11, 1923-April 28, 1998) was a United States science fiction author and editor. He also used the pseudonyms D.B. Lewis, Harry Neal, Albert Russell, J. Russell, M. St. Vivant, Thornecliff Herrick and Alger Rome.

He was Editor of Planet Stories, from Summer 1950 to July 1951; and was editor of Two Complete Science Adventure Novels from Winter 1950 to July 1951.

Probably his most well known work today is the Star Trek episode Mirror, Mirror.
